True, because the standard deviation describes how far, on average, each observation is from the typical value. A larger standard deviation means that observations are more distant from the typical value, and therefore, more dispersed.

First, convert the 65% to a real mathematical number. For percents, this is always done by dividing the 65% by 100%, or 65% / 100% = 0.650.
Second, find out what 65% of $60 is. This is the amount of the sale discount. This is always found by mulitplying 0.650 by the item's cost $60, like this:
0.650 x $60 = $39.00.
So for this sale, you'll save $39.00 on this item.
This means, the cost of the item to you is
<span>$60 - $39.00 = $21.00.</span>
